Candidates
Name | Party | Votes | % | +/- |
---|---|---|---|---|
Chris Skidmore | Conservative | 19,362 | 40.4 | +8.3 |
Roger Berry | Labour | 16,917 | 35.3 | -10.6 |
Sally FitzHarris | Liberal Democrat | 8,072 | 16.8 | -1.2 |
Neil Dowdney | UK Independence Party | 1,528 | 3.2 | +0.8 |
Michael Carey | British National Party | 1,311 | 2.7 | +2.7 |
Nick Foster | Green | 383 | 0.8 | +0.8 |
Michael Blundell | English Democrats | 333 | 0.7 | +0.7 |
Majority | 2,445 | 5.1 | ||
Turnout | 47,906 | 72.2 | +3.0 |
